IT Glitches at Hargreaves Lansdown Finally Resolved
A series of technical issues that crippled the website and mobile application of UK-based financial services firm Hargreaves Lansdown have been resolved, according to a statement from the company. The disruptions, which affected thousands of users, caused frustration among customers who were unable to access their accounts or conduct trades. The firm acknowledged that its systems had experienced “unprecedented” levels of activity, leading to the issues. It assured investors and customers that emergency measures had been put in place to mitigate the problem and restore service as quickly as possible. Hargreaves Lansdown’s IT team worked tirelessly to resolve the issue, with assistance from external experts. The company has apologized for the inconvenience caused and promised to investigate the root cause of the problem to prevent similar disruptions in the future. The resolution comes after a period of heightened scrutiny of the firm’s technical infrastructure following reports of the IT issues. Hargreaves Lansdown has taken steps to enhance its disaster recovery procedures and invest in its technology to improve resilience.
